When is the ideal season for tree pruning?
The optimal timing for pruning will differ depending on the type of tree and where you live. As a whole, it's best to have a tree pruner cut back your trees during the dormant time of year.
Winter season is a great time for tree maintenance because the rest of your backyard should not require any focus throughout that time. Thinning trees preceding the springtime sprouting and growing season will permit your trees to shoot out as well as flourish well.
There is typically no problem doing tree maintenance throughout the spring and summertime too, particularly if there is any type of dead wood, illness, or overgrowth.
Palm Tree Pruning
Palm trees need a good deal of care during pruning. Cutting the limbs at the wrong time can leave them helpless against diseases. Palm trees need to be pruned when the older growth has turned brown and died. This is generally one or two times in a year.
Staying on top of routine maintenance is important for avoiding damages as well as injuries from hard and massive dropping palm branches.
Pine Tree Pruning
The very best time to cut back your pine trees is during the very first part of spring, however if at any time you discover dying or infected branches, it's a good idea to care for those.
Using appropriate pruning techniques is truly important. Hacking back branches to shorten them, is honestly a bad idea because it might stop the branch from growing entirely. That might leave the branch stunted and off balance forever.
In the springtime when the pine tree begins to grow out, crimping back the fresh growth tips can provide a compact and thick growth that is particularly eye-catching.
